Summary:
Plasma treatment is a novel and promising technolgy in the field of wood surface modification. Deposition of micro-particles on wood surfaces by means of plasma is an interesting approach to enhance wood properties and thus, to extend the service life of wood products. On the other hand, several silicone fomulations have been already shown to cause excellent water repellence and interaction with cell wall components, beside to impart high chenical and weathering stability as well as biological resistance in treated wood. Based on that, this study focussed on both treatments separately in an initial stage of the research; followed by the combination, in a two-step treatment, of vacuum-pressure impregnation of solid wook with siloxanes and additional copper deposition on wood surface using atmostpheric pressure plasma.
